Will the roads be closed to traffic for the bike section that is not on track?
I did this race 2 years ago and it is fantastic, but I would never do it again if the roads are not closed, way too risky.

We deploy over 6,000 36" reflective collar cones at ~10lbs each, dropped every white hash or 30ft. Bikes have a dedicated lane (median lane) and vehicles flow in the outside/curb lane. We also have over 120 law enforcement and traffic control personnel. We invest heavily in athlete safety. The one bummer is the aid station is left sided, but that one double sided location is hit four times at miles 20, 30, 40, 50. It is a 2 lap section. 11 miles out, 11 back on the other side of the median. Done twice, that makes up 44 of the miles through the Tiger Bay State Forest.
